Album stand out ‘Don’t Let Love Get You Down’ is an exemplar of weightless, grooving seventies soul while the album title track is 4 minutes of dazzling Philly instrumentation matched with the Drells’ sweet vocal harmonies. This is peak-PIR, unashamedly euphoric and accessible, throwing everything into the mix — there’s a speed-limit-breaking jazz guitar solo here, an orchestral stab there, and a horn riff or string lick squeezed into every possible space. Maximal seventies disco-soul.
